Carmicheal are seeking an Excavated Materials Manager to join the team working on a major infrastructure project based in Milton Keynes.
In this role, you will act as the principal earthworks, excavated and imported materials point of contact for the Contractor, reporting to the Project Manager. You will produce and implement the Excavated Materials Plan and all the Materials Management Plans. You will ensure compliance with all legislation concerning earthworks and with the contractual requirements, including Materials Tracking Documents, Materials Management Plans and Verification Reporting.
The Excavated Materials Manager will co-ordinate and oversee all excavations within made ground including watching briefs, stockpile segregation and re-use testing. This position will ensure that materials being utilised in the works is in accordance with the Works Information and the re-use criteria. The role will own and oversee a number of soils and excavated materials Undertakings and Assurances.
This role will co-ordinate with others regarding cumulative impacts of earthworks movement both within and outside the works. The role will also work with the environmental, traffic and waste managers to ensure all corresponding plans are coordinated and followed and ensure the compliance of the earthworks and imported materials to those plans.
This position will co-ordinate with the construction teams and customer liaison managers to provide corrective and preventative actions to any incidents or complaints that might arise as part of the earthworks and import of materials.
